Bijotat cheered by late win

Sunday 27 November, 2005


Sochaux boss Dominique Bijotat believes his team’s courage was the decisive factor in their 1-0 win over Rennes.

The Brittany side had several chances to score before Benjamin Genghini struck a last-gasp winner for the home team.

“We were up against an excellent Rennes side tonight,” said Bijotat, whose position looks more secure after two victories in a week. “We had to be really solid and well-positioned to get the result.

"They have two of three chances, we also had several. But we often struggle towards the end of the games. This time we showed enough heart and enough strength.”

Bijotat was also keen to praise the contribution of his substitutes and, in particular, Genghini who marked his first appearance with a goal. “I’ve been telling the players in the last fortnight that I wasn’t happy with the subs, that they’re not adding anything extra.

“In this game I felt that the guys who came on had a totally different spirit,” he added.
